Essa Bokar Sey, a former Gambian ambassador to China and USA, has opposed President Adama Barrow’s bid for a third term.

Mr. Sey’s opposition comes just days after President Barrow publicly announced his intention to seek a third term in 2026. Many Gambians have been calling on him to respect term limits.

“I, Ambassador Essa Bokarr Sey, hereby make it categorically clear that I do not support a third-term agenda for the incumbent, nor will I ever support it for any future leader in The Gambia, Inshaa Allah,”he wrote on his Facebook page.

“I urge you not to support a third-term agenda for the incumbent in The Gambia or any future leader who pushes a similar agenda.”

He emphasised the importance of term limits, criticising attempts to extend leadership indefinitely.

“The failure to respect term limits,

Attempts to push for a third term, fourth term, or indefinite-term agendas,

Tampering with constitutions, these are threats to democracy,” he stated.

“Driven by passion and guided by principle, I want to be on record: I do not support a third-term agenda for the incumbent in The Gambia, and I will never support it for any future leader.”
